Ingredients


– 6 large eggs
– 1 cup fresh spinach, chopped
– ½ cup feta cheese, crumbled
– ¼ cup milk
– 1 small onion, finely chopped
– 1 garlic clove, minced
– 1 teaspoon salt
– ½ teaspoon black pepper
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– Optional: red pepper flakes for a bit of heat

Step-by-Step Instructions


Making Easy Mini Spinach & Feta Frittatas is incredibly simple. Follow these steps to achieve perfect mini frittatas that are sure to impress:
1.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a muffin tin with cooking spray or olive oil.
2. Sauté the Vegetables: In a skillet over medium heat, add the olive oil. Once heated, add the chopped onion and garlic. Sauté until transl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
3. Add Spinach: Add the chopped spinach to the skillet and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, until wilted. Remove from heat.
4. Whisk Eggs: In a mixing bowl, crack the eggs and whisk together with the milk, salt, and black pepper until well combined.
5. Combine Ingredients: Fold the sautéed spinach mixture and crumbled feta cheese into the egg mixture until evenly distributed.
6. Fill Muffin Tin: Pour the egg and spinach mixture evenly into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cavity about three-quarters full.
7. Bake: Place the muffin tin in the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the frittatas are set in the middle and lightly golden on top.
8. Cool and Serve: Allow the mini frittatas to cool for a few minutes in the tray before gently removing them.
9. Garnish: Optionally, sprinkle with additional feta or fresh herbs before serving.
10. Enjoy: Serve warm or at room temperature.

Additional Tips


– Use Fresh Spinach: For the best flavor and texture, opt for fresh spinach rather than frozen. Fresh spinach will provide a vibrant color and taste that frozen spinach cannot match.
– Experiment with Cheese: While feta is wonderfully creamy, consider using goat cheese, cheddar, or mozzarella for a different flavor twist.
– Spices and Herbs: Enhance your frittatas by adding herbs like dill, basil, or parsley. A sprinkle of nutmeg can also elevate the flavors beautifully.
– Customize Vegetable Add-ins: Feel free to include additional vegetables such as bell peppers, zucchini, or mushrooms for added nutrition and flavor.
– Baking Time: Keep an eye on the baking time; ovens can vary. The frittatas should be set and lightly golden on top when done.

Recipe Variation


Looking to experiment? Here are some fun variations of Easy Mini Spinach & Feta Frittatas:
1. Mediterranean Style: Add sun-dried tomatoes and olives to create a Greek-inspired flavor profile.
2. Breakfast Meat: Mix in cooked crumbled sausage or bacon for a hearty breakfast option.
3. Different Greens: Swap spinach for kale or Swiss chard for a unique taste experience.
4. Vegan Version: Substitute eggs with a flaxseed meal mixture or silken tofu blended until smooth and add nutritional yeast for cheesy flavor.

Freezing and Storage


– Storage: Store the mini frittatas in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They will stay fresh for up to 4-5 days.
– Freezing: For longer storage, freeze the frittatas. Place them in a single layer on a baking sheet to freeze,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ag. They can be frozen for up to 3 months. To reheat, simply bake from frozen until warmed through.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use egg substitutes for this recipe?
Yes, egg substitutes like flax eggs, aquafaba, or commercial egg replacements can be used for a vegan version. Adjust quantities based on the substitute you choose.
How can I tell when they are done baking?
The frittatas should be puffed and lightly golden on top. A toothpick inserted into the center should come out clean.
Can I make the batter in advance?
Yes! You can prepare the batter a day ahead. Store it in the refrigerator, then pour it into the muffin tin and bake when ready.
What can I serve these frittatas with?
Pair them with a fresh salad, fruit, or yogurt for a balanced meal. They also make great finger food for parties!
Are these frittatas suitable for a gluten-free diet?
Absolutely! The ingredients used are naturally gluten-free, making them a great option for those with gluten sensitivities.
